Two of my ancestors are Mary Edith SEATLE (b.1852, Ulverston) and Joseph Hodgson SAWREY (b. 1851, Derbyshire). They married at St Cuthbert’s, Lytham in 1880 and both were living in Ulverston in both 1871 and 1881. Their youngest son, Walter Henry SAWREY, was born in Plimpton in 1890. There is some mystery surrounding their deaths. My distant kin, with whom I have now lost touch, have a possible death for Joseph in San Francisco in 1900, and a definite death for Mary in Puebla, Mexico in 1918. It all seems a bit odd: why emigrate to Mexico of all places, and how did they end up in separate countries? All my research so far has been in the UK and I’m a bit stuck as to where to go from here.
